    The major leagues saw all eight scheduled games played on August 3, 1920. It was a bit of an all or nothing day as four games generated no more than five runs, three of those ending in 3-1 scores. The other four games generated at least twelve runs, with two fifteen run contests as the high scoring games of the day.

    Ross Youngs of the Giants takes home best offensive game of the day honors as he helps down the Reds 11-1. Youngs posts a three for four day with a walk, a triple and a home run. This is Youngs’s second time recording best game of the day, and the third time he was in the running. Each of these great offensive days included triples. Youngs would hit 93 triples in a ten year career, breaking double digits five times. He is on a hot streak batting .476/.535/.651 in his last 16 games.

    Red Farber of the White Sox pitches the best game of the day according to game scores, beating out 坚果加速器下载 of the Red Sox 74-73. Farber, in a 3-1 win against the Yankees, allows five hits but also walked five batters. He struck out six. Pennock, in a 3-1 win against the Tigers, allowed six hits but did not walk a batter, only striking out two. That actually seems like a better afternoon to me. Farber, however, faced a much tougher opponent. Three of his walks were to Babe Ruth, one intentional, and that strategy may have been imposed on him. So Farber will indeed take home best pitched game of the day honors.

    Jim Bagby of the Indians wins his twenty second game of the season as Cleveland beats Washington 10-5. He leads the AL and the majors in that category.

    Tris Speaker of the Indians goes on for three in that game to reduce his batting average to .418. George Sisler of the Browns takes advantage of the drop to close the gap a bit, his three for four day raising his batting average to .402.

    The Indians win coupled with the White Sox beating the Yankees gives Cleveland a four game lead for the AL pennant. The Yankees sit in second, but they are six games down in the loss column. The White Sox are now in spitting distance of second place, 5 1/2 games out of first.

    In the NL, the Dodgers beat the Cardinals 11-4. Coupled with the Giants win over the Reds, the Dodgers hold a 2 1/2 game lead for the league title. The Giants remain five games back as the three teams wind up evenly spaced.

    Pat Murphy, bench coach for the Milwaukee Brewers, suffered a heart attack on Saturday:

    The sixty-one year old Murphy joined the Brewers’ organization in 2016. Craig Counsell first wanted his old coach at Notre Dame on his staff when he took the Brewers’ managerial job in 2015, but the San Diego Padres refused to let Milwaukee interview him. Murphy did become the Padres’ interim manager later in 2015 after the firing of Bud Black.

    This Date in 1920

    All sixteen teams play the nine scheduled games on August 2, 1920, including a doubleheader between the Tigers and the Red Sox. The Indians beat the Senators 2-0 in Cleveland for the low scoring game of the day, one of many games reported in the paper to have 坚果网络加速器. In this case, it was pinch hitter George Burns doubling in the only runs of the game in the bottom of the eighth inning. At the high end, the Brown trounced the Athletics 10-8.

    Babe Ruth of the Yankees once again takes home best offensive game of the day honors in the 7-0 win over the White Sox in Chicago. The Sultan of Swat collects two hits and two walks in five plate appearances, hitting a double and his 38th home run to lead the majors. Only one team owns more home runs than Ruth, the Phillies with 41. The next closest teams are the Browns and Athletics with 32.

    Stan Coveleski of the Indians wins best pitched game of the day with his shutout of the Senators. He allows just five hits and two walks in nine innings, striking out six batters along the way. A look at the leaders link above, shows that Coveleski is not only among the leaders in the work stats (starts, innings, etc.) but one with a low ERA and a high strikeout rate. He ranks fifth in Tom Tango Cy Young Tracker points through 8/2, but first in Bill James Cy Young points.

    Tris Speaker of the Indians goes 1 for 2 with two walks to stay well above .400 at .419. George Sisler of the Browns does gain on Speaker a little with a 3 for 5 day, now batting .398.

    The wins by the Indians and Yankees keep Cleveland in first place by three games and dump the White Sox 5 1/2 games back in the AL pennant race.

    In the NL, the Cardinals beat the Dodgers 4-1, and the Giants continue their winning ways with a 5-2 victory over the World Champion Reds. Brooklyn remains 1 1/2 games ahead of Cincinnati, with the Giants now just five games back in third place.

    An Economist on Baseball

    Tyler Cowen suggests a penalty for positive tests to keep baseball players healthy:

     … dock a player 30 percent of his salary if he tests positive.  That should limit the degree of nightclubbing and carousing, keeping in mind that the already-infected are probably some of the worst offenders and they have been “taken care of.”

    If need be, the fines can be redistributed to the players who never test positive, thus keeping total compensation constant.

    MarginalRevolution.com

    My experience is that people tend to find this type of system yucky*. See anti-price gouging laws during a disaster. Sometimes yucky is the better way to deal with things, however.

    Cowen mentions needing union approval, but note that the players could institute this themselves without the league approving, just as they could have implemented PED testing and fines.
